Rei-Den Shrine, located in Tochigi Prefecture, is dedicated to the Shinto god of storms and lightning, Raijin. Built in 1861, the shrine's main hall is a wooden structure adorned with vermilion decorations. The surrounding area features beautifully manicured gardens, showcasing the perfect balance between nature and architecture.

Cultural notes
Raijin is also associated with fertility and prosperity. The shrine hosts a traditional festival in late May, where participants wear traditional attire and perform rituals to ensure good fortune and a bountiful harvest.
Historical note
The shrine was rebuilt after being destroyed during World War II.
